No, there is no direct bus from Svilengrad to Athens. However, there are services departing from Svilengrad and arriving at Athens Karolou via Plovdiv Hristo Botev.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 18h 18m.
The distance between Svilengrad and Athens is 594 km. The road distance is 875.4 km.
